Music Teacher Jobs in Illinois
A Music Teacher in elementary education is responsible for developing students' music skills and appreciation. They conduct lessons that involve singing, playing musical instruments, and understanding music theory. Music Teachers also introduce various types of music to the children, helping them to explore their musical interests and talents. They prepare lesson plans and teaching materials for each class, evaluate student performance, and provide constructive feedback. Music Teachers also organize music-related activities such as choir practice, band rehearsals, and concerts.
Important skills and certifications a Music Teacher should have include a Bachelor's degree in Music Education, a teaching certification, and excellent musical skills. They should also have strong communication and class management skills, patience, creativity, and the ability to motivate and inspire students. Prior to becoming a Music Teacher, an individual may have roles such as a Private Music Tutor, a Band Director, or a Music Therapist. These roles provide valuable experience in teaching and working with students in a musical context.
